Real-World Application: From Tote Bags to Sweatshirts

To truly evaluate these assets, I imagined placing them on actual products I might stock in my boutique or sell as custom orders. Let’s talk about a custom embroidered tote bag. Using the largest size available, which measures 5.8 inches, the tote bag design becomes a statement piece. The outline format ensures that even if the canvas is slightly textured, the definition of the pumpkins and candles remains crisp. The negative space within the outlines prevents the stitching from puckering, a common issue when using high-density fill stitches on thicker bags.

Now, consider sweatshirt embroidery. This is where the versatility of having five different sizes becomes critical. For a chest pocket placement on a crewneck, the 3.8-inch version works beautifully. It’s large enough to be seen but small enough not to distort the knit fabric. If you are creating custom apparel for a small business, this scalability allows you to use the same motif across hoodies, aprons, and caps without redesigning anything. The outline structure is particularly forgiving on stretchy fabrics because there is less bulk pulling against the weave compared to a solid block of satin stitch.

I also tested the concept of using this as an embroidered patch. Because the lines are defined and the shapes are distinct, these designs would translate perfectly into patches for jackets or denim vests. The clear separation between elements like the bow and the candle means that even with the added thickness of felt backing, the details won't get lost.

Navigating Fabric Challenges and Stitch Density

While the design is robust, every professional knows that context is everything. You must exercise caution when applying Cozy Season Outline Embroidery Designs to very thin fabrics or highly textured surfaces. On a sheer scarf, the outline might show through too much, potentially requiring a specific stabilizer strategy. Similarly, on a thick, looped towel, the needle might struggle to catch the loops consistently in the tightest corners of the candle flames or bow ribbons.

Stitch density is another factor to monitor. While outline designs generally have lower density than fill stitches, the way the machine executes the turns in the pumpkin stems or the curves of the bows matters. Always run a test on scrap fabric first. Check the thread colors you plan to use; a dark outline on a dark background will vanish, while a light outline on a light fabric needs a contrasting underlay to pop. This is crucial for maintaining the visual appeal and ensuring your customer sees the quality you intend.
